Shawn
A 4 setting should dig well off to the side. The slower you run the less it will side plane. At 2.3-2.5 it should dig well to the side on 4. You want to be careful if you are fighting a fish on a rigger line and you slow the boat down. If you go too slow they will drop into your cables. 4 is a good setting to run right now. As the fish stage at 50 plus I like a setting of 2.5 to 3 to maximize depth. I would never run a setting less than 2.5 with riggers in the mix. The accessories(4oz weight and rings) can also be a great enhancement for getting deeper.
Thorny
